Results below include those reported under the school’s previous registration: Sidney Stringer School - Specialising in Mathematics and Computing (URN 103739, until 1 September 2010).
Of the 211 pupils who finished Year 11 at Sidney Stringer Academy in 2023, 61% stayed on in Sidney Stringer Academy’s own sixth form (Coventry average 46%), 24% went to a further education college and 1% started an apprenticeship.
Among the 163 students who left the sixth form in 2023, 60% went to university (Coventry 39%, England 37%), and 14% of level 3 students progressed to one of the most selective universities, against 19% nationally.
Spanish is unusually popular at GCSE: 61% of the year group took it, against 19% of pupils across England.
GCSE results in 2025 were below the national picture: Attainment 8 of 40.1 against 46.1 across England and 44.0 in Coventry, with 35% of pupils getting grade 5 or above in both English and maths (England 45%).

Progress 8 is not available for 2025 and 2026: these cohorts had no Key Stage 2 tests in 2020 and 2021, so there is no baseline. Attainment 8 shows results without taking pupils’ starting points into account.
